Sandwiches

Eufaula, AL, United States

6 places in Eufaula, ordered by rating:

4.5
20 reviews
Telephone:
+1 334-687-5001
Address:
347 S Eufaula Ave Ste 2
3.8
5 reviews
Telephone:
+1 334-687-9184
Address:
207 E Broad St
2.0
1 review
Telephone:
+1 334-616-6020
Address:
1218 S Eufaula Ave
···
Telephone:
+1 334-687-7759
Address:
815 S Eufaula Ave
···
Telephone:
+1 334-687-7700
Address:
Highway 431 S
···
Telephone:
+1 334-616-0903
Address:
147 N Eufaula Ave